National Restoration Operations Manager

1 week ago


San Francisco, California, United States BluSky Full time
Position Overview:
The National Restoration Operations Manager is a dynamic role that involves extensive travel and is accountable for the daily management of all assigned restoration initiatives for significant commercial properties. This includes, but is not limited to, the selection of temporary labor, procurement and management of equipment, on-site supervision, ensuring paperwork accuracy, and maintaining quality standards.

Compensation Package:
Base Salary Range: $85,000 - $110,000
Additional CAT (Catastrophic) Pay: $750 per week during specific events.
Commission OTE Range: $50,000 - $100,000
Travel Per Diem: $346 per week to assist with travel-related expenses.
Vehicle Allowance: $500 per month plus fuel reimbursement.
Region: Nationwide support with up to 100% travel and a hands-on approach.

Key Responsibilities:
Field Management:
  • Direct oversight of the Restoration Technician Team.
  • Respond to large-scale losses alongside the first responder team.
  • Recruit and manage temporary labor resources in collaboration with the Project Coordinator.
  • Oversee all large commercial and residential restoration projects.
  • Ensure all demolition is thorough and prepared for rebuilding.
  • Conduct safety toolbox talks and ensure compliance with company safety policies.
  • Manage time and material project sign-in sheets.
  • Adhere to OSHA and environmental regulations.
  • Guarantee project work meets the highest industry standards.
  • Supervise BluSky and temporary labor personnel on-site as necessary.
  • Follow all company best practices.
  • Provide exceptional customer service at all times.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Office/Shop Management:
  • Review and manage project-related paperwork.
  • Ensure all subcontractors and temporary laborers operate under a subcontract agreement.
  • Approve or reject invoices with proper communication to the Project Accountant.
  • Develop and adjust project schedules as required.
  • Monitor and approve employee timecards.
  • Conduct monthly strategy meetings with direct reports.
  • Ensure IICRC training is current for all Technician personnel.
  • Hold team meetings for training and equipment checks.
  • Act as the direct report for the Shop Manager.
  • Ensure equipment is operational and ready for deployment.
  • Maintain and update equipment inventory lists monthly.
  • Ensure vehicles are stocked according to company specifications.
  • Direct, mentor, and train Technician personnel.
  • Participate in the company’s emergency mitigation on-call management rotation.
Profitability Management:
  • Achieve or surpass billing, revenue, and profit margin objectives set by the company.
  • Utilize temporary labor resources to avoid unnecessary overtime, excluding after-hours emergencies.
Qualifications:
  • 3-5 years of experience in residential and commercial restoration.
  • 3+ years of project management experience.
  • IICRC certifications in water and smoke restoration.
  • Willingness to travel for both emergency and non-emergency situations nationwide.
  • Strong communication skills with clients and internal/external stakeholders throughout the project management process.
